- Abstract
Objective: Studies on academic career awareness may support the development of physiotherapists' academic and professional roles and status by providing specialization in a certain field. In this study, it was aimed to investigate the factors affecting the academic career awareness of senior physiotherapy and rehabilitation (PTR) students who are in the career planning stage. Method: The study was conducted with 227 PTR senior students studying in six different universities in Ankara, three of which are state (Hacettepe, Gazi, and Ankara Yıldırım Beyazıt University) and three of which are private (Lokman Hekim, Başkent, and Atılım University), in the 2021-2022 academic year. "Personal Information Form" and "Academic Career Awareness Scale (ACAS)" were used as data collection tools. The factors affecting the total score of ACAS were analyzed by multiple linear regression analysis. Results: The study was completed with 227 (Female: 186, 82%) FTR senior students with a mean age of 22.6±1.3 years, 134 (59%) of whom were studying at a state university and 93 (41%) at a private university. It was determined that the factors affecting the total score of ACAS were being informed about the academic career (B=12.22, p<0.001), postgraduate education status in the family/close environment (role model) (B=5.97, p=0.006), department satisfaction (B=1.54, p=0.001), and taking the Academic Personnel and Postgraduate Education Entrance Exam (ALES) (B=5.01, p=0.022). It was observed that these four variables explained 24% of the cumulative variance in the dependent variable (total score of ACAS) (R2=0.243). Conclusion: It was found that being informed about academic career, postgraduate education status in the family/close environment (role model), department satisfaction, and taking ALES were the factors affecting academic career awareness. For physiotherapy candidates to develop academic career awareness, it may be beneficial to establish career offices in higher education institutions, incorporate careerrelated elective courses in the curriculum, or schedule seminars regularly. Furthermore, academic career awareness may also be increased by helping students with an academic career plan in choosing a role model, enabling them to communicate with the role model, and establishing procedures to improve students' department satisfaction.
